# Transport of Gallery Labels — Merrowfield Hall, East Wing

The printed labels for the new Tidewater Ceramics gallery travel in two flat archival cases, each sealed with numbered tamper tape. Labels are sorted by display case and must remain in their interleaved folders; do not fan or restack them on arrival. Keep the cases horizontal and away from direct sunlight during unloading. Receiving staff should check seal numbers against the enclosed sheet before signing. For the courier hand-over itself, the confidential instruction is:

courier memo of tajog-kawig: the rusok ulair courier leaves the julax silax ulaael ledger at gate 1555 under passcode 233009

Ticket: DEDUP-412 — Connection failures during customer record dedup

The Larkspur dedup job started failing overnight with pool exhaustion errors. It merges duplicate customer records in batches of 500, but the batch worker isn't releasing connections after a merge conflict, so the pool drains within twenty minutes. Proposed fix: wrap merges in a try/finally release and cap retries at three. For the sync, reproduce against staging using the connection string below.

primary connection of bagep-kaweg = clickhouse://rusdor_svc:3TXlgH7O8DuUYI@db-ae3f.zarqelgrid.internal:5432/zordor

### Ticket: Drift in Fieldnote offline settings

Several plugin authors have reported that the Fieldnote offline queue behaves differently across customer installs, despite identical plugin code. Investigation shows the offline configuration on two tenant clusters has drifted from the published reference, likely from manual hotfixes last quarter. Plugins should not work around this; we will reconcile centrally. For comparison, the canonical reference values are reproduced below.

settings of yageg-yahap:
[gorael]
team = olieth
access_code = ac_941d74
owner = brieth.aldiel
host = gorael.tolvaqio.internal
port = 6379
peer = briwyn.urlaqtech.internal
salt = 116e6622
pin = 1957